Drive Character

Expect a drive that leans heavily on highway travel, with 67% of your time spent on major routes. You will start by navigating I-64, which accounts for your longest uninterrupted stretch of 27.2 miles. As you transition off the interstate, the journey continues along the Fruth-Lanham Highway and WV 62. This combination provides a practical mix of fast-paced highway driving and local road segments. The overall personality of the route is straightforward and efficient, ideal for those who prefer a predictable path over complex navigation.

Turn-by-Turn Driving Directions

Step-by-step road directions between Huntington, WV and Buffalo, WV.

1

Start on 8th Street

0.3 mi · 1 min · 8th Street
2

Turn left onto 8th Avenue

0.8 mi · 2 min · 8th Avenue
3

Turn right onto Hal Greer Boulevard

0.6 mi · 1 min · Hal Greer Boulevard
4

Keep slight right to continue on Hal Greer Boulevard

0.3 mi · 42 sec · Hal Greer Boulevard
5

Continue on Troy Brown Way

1.7 mi · 2 min · Troy Brown Way
6

Take the ramp slight left

0.3 mi · 43 sec
7

Merge slight left

27 mi · 29 min
8

Take the exit slight right toward WV 34: Teays Valley

0.2 mi · 38 sec · WV 34: Teays Valley
9

Turn left onto Teays Valley Road

2.0 mi · 3 min · Teays Valley Road
10

Take the ramp left

0.4 mi · 51 sec
11

Merge slight left onto Fruth-Lanham Highway

8.6 mi · 9 min · Fruth-Lanham Highway
12

Take the exit slight right toward WV 62: Buffalo, Eleanor

0.2 mi · 34 sec · WV 62: Buffalo, Eleanor
13

Keep slight left to continue on Shamrock Road

407 ft · 13 sec · Shamrock Road
14

Turn right onto WV 869

0.6 mi · 47 sec · WV 869
15

Continue on WV 869

0.6 mi · 1 min · WV 869
16

At the end of the road, turn left

2.6 mi · 4 min
17

Turn straight onto River Street

33 ft · 2 sec · River Street
18

Arrive at your destination
